Advisory ID: SUSE-SU-2026:3030-1
Released: Wed Jul 15 11:53:06 2026
Summary: Security update for glibc
Type: security
Severity: moderate
References: 1263656,1263658,CVE-2026-5435,CVE-2026-6238
This update for glibc fixes the following issues
- CVE-2026-5435: unchecked buffer writing in TSIG handling can lead to an out-of-bounds write (bsc#1263656).
- CVE-2026-6238: insufficient RDATA length validation can lead to application crashes or uninitialized memory disclosure
(bsc#1263658).
